So I just updated my 9900 to the 7.1 update from Telus. When I want to text my girlfriend I usually use emoticons in the messages. She has a curve 9360 but no bbm (not included in her plan ) but ever since I updated to the 7.1 update..there is absolutely no option for 'data coding' in the text messages menu. It was there before and now it's nowhere to be found. I want to change it to 'UCS2' but now I can't...can anybody help me?
It is still there, however now it is automatic and switches between 7 bit and UCS2 automatically if you use any special characters in the message. It is in text messages options and just enable "Allow Special Characters" option. I can confirm that it works because as soon as I turned it on it let me send characters in different language.
